The discussion features within other LMS platforms refer to built-in or integrated tools that facilitate online communication and collaboration among students and instructors. These features typically include discussion forums, threads, commenting systems, and interactive Q&A sections designed to promote asynchronous dialogue, peer support, and community engagement throughout the learning process.

Key Features

  • Threaded discussions with hierarchical reply structure
  • Real-time notifications for new posts or replies
  • Emojis, file attachments, and multimedia integration
  • Moderation tools for instructors or moderators
  • Voting or ranking systems for posts
  • Search functionality within discussion threads
  • Anonymous posting options
  • Integration with grading systems for participation assessments

Pros

  • Encourages active student participation and engagement
  • Supports asynchronous communication, accommodating different schedules
  • Facilitates peer-to-peer learning and collaboration
  • Easy to moderate and manage discussions for instructors
  • Enhances community building within courses

Cons

  • Can become cluttered without proper organization
  • Potential for off-topic or unproductive discussions
  • Requires active moderation to prevent misuse or spam
  • May be less effective if students are reluctant to participate
